"Karsha, Zanskar. There are four major schools or sects within Tibetan Buddhism: Nyingma, Kagyu, Sakyu and Gelug. The Karsha monks belong to the Gelug or ‘Yellow Hat’ order, the newest of the four schools to form, founded in 1409. Nyingma, the first school, was founded in the 8th century."
